Structure of the Manual

The Behold Your Little Ones nursery manual is organized into a clear and user-friendly format, making it easy for teachers to plan and conduct lessons․ The manual begins with an introduction and a letter to parents, outlining the purpose and goals of the nursery class․ It is divided into 30 lessons, each focusing on specific gospel topics such as the love of Heavenly Father, the mission of Jesus Christ, and the importance of prayer․ Each lesson includes a lesson outline, suggested activities, and resources like crafts and coloring pages to engage young children․ The manual also provides teaching tips and ideas for creating a nurturing environment․ This structured approach ensures that teachers can deliver age-appropriate content effectively, helping children build a strong spiritual foundation․ The manual’s design supports consistency and flexibility, allowing teachers to adapt lessons to meet the needs of their class while staying focused on key gospel principles․

Lesson 1: I Am a Child of God

Lesson 1 introduces young children to the foundational truth that they are beloved children of Heavenly Father․ Through simple stories, songs, and activities, nursery leaders help children feel loved and special․ Crafts and coloring pages reinforce the message of divine identity, creating a positive and uplifting environment․ This lesson lays the groundwork for spiritual growth, teaching children to recognize their worth and the love Heavenly Father has for them․ It encourages feelings of joy and security, helping little ones begin their journey of understanding gospel principles․ The activities are designed to engage young minds and hearts, making this first lesson a meaningful and memorable experience․

Lesson 2: Heavenly Father Has a Plan for Me

Lesson 2 helps children understand that Heavenly Father has a special plan for each of them․ Through engaging stories and visual aids, nursery leaders teach that Heavenly Father loves His children and desires their happiness․ Activities include discussing the concept of families and how they are part of Heavenly Father’s plan․ Crafts and coloring pages reinforce the idea that each child has a purpose and is loved․ This lesson builds on the previous one by introducing the idea of a divine plan, helping children feel secure and valued․ It encourages them to think about their role in the world and their relationship with Heavenly Father․ The activities are simple yet meaningful, ensuring young children can grasp this important gospel principle and feel a sense of belonging and purpose․

Lesson 3: Jesus Christ Is the Son of Heavenly Father

Lesson 3 introduces young children to the concept that Jesus Christ is the Son of Heavenly Father․ Through simple stories and engaging activities, nursery leaders help children understand Jesus’ role as a loving brother and Savior․ Crafts and coloring pages focus on images of Jesus, reinforcing His divine identity․ This lesson builds on the previous teachings about Heavenly Father, helping children grasp the relationship between the Father and the Son․ The activities emphasize Jesus’ love for all people and His mission to help us return to Heavenly Father․ Nursery leaders use songs and prayer to create a reverent atmosphere, encouraging children to feel close to Jesus․ This lesson lays a foundational understanding of the Savior’s role in their lives, fostering a sense of love and reverence for Him․ The interactive approach ensures children engage with the teachings in a meaningful and memorable way․

Engaging Young Children with Stories

Stories are a powerful way to engage young children in nursery lessons, as they capture their attention and imagination․ The Behold Your Little Ones manual incorporates simple, age-appropriate stories to teach gospel principles․ These narratives often include scripture stories, parables, and examples of children interacting with Jesus Christ․ Stories about prophets, like Joseph Smith’s prayer in the Sacred Grove, help children connect with spiritual experiences․ By listening to these stories, children begin to understand and feel the love of Heavenly Father and Jesus Christ․ The manual encourages teachers to use expressive voices, gestures, and questions to involve the children, making the stories more relatable and meaningful․ This method not only teaches doctrine but also fosters a sense of wonder and curiosity, helping young children build a strong spiritual foundation․ Through stories, nursery leaders can create a nurturing environment where children feel safe to learn and grow․
